/Snow-White-Global-Offensive

Developed by José Augusto, Hugo Tallys, Valério Nogueira and Thiago José

Primary LanguageC++

Projeto de Programação 1 (2017.1)

Clique aqui para ir ao site do jogo.

Pré-requisitos

Library Allegro instalada.
Para jogar basta rodar o executável ./a.out ou game.exe dentro da pasta do jogo para Linux e Windows, respectivamente.

Apreendimentos

Durante todo o primeiro período aprendemos conceitos que foram utilizados exaustivamente neste projeto. Além do que foi aprendido, absorvemos conceitos como o de Finite-State Machine utilizados na inteligência de todos bosses, aplicamos como regra e entendemos a importância do bom uso da Geometria e parte de Álgebra na otimização de movimentos e fixamos conceitos mais gerais de um jogo, desde à mudança de estado entre fases, bosses e estados de morte até o empilhamento e desempilhamento dos loops menu->main_game->menu-> main_game->bosses->death_screen_->menu e suas respectivas funções. Não menos importante, o excelente trabalho em equipe foi característica intrísica e visível a todos que vislumbraram o desenvolvimento do jogo por nossa equipe. De fato, aprendemos e apreendemos.

Feito por

  • Hugo Tallys Martins de Oliveira
  • José Augusto dos Santos Silva
  • Thiago José Silva Santos
  • Valério Nogueira Rodrigues Júnior

Agradecimentos

Agradecimentos ao Professor Rodrigo Paes e a Alfredo Lima, ambos pela instrução e motivação.

Baixar

O jogo está disponível para Linux e Windows.
Clique aqui para ir para página de download.

Contato

Na nossa página de Contatos, embaixo da foto de cada um de nós, há o respectivo e-mail para contato.
Clique aqui para ser redirecionado para a página de Contatos em nosso site.